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of pipeline positioning technology, specifically to a positioning fixture for pipeline coiling and shaping. Background Technology
[0002] In the fields of medical aesthetics and clinical treatment, blood purification technology has been widely used to improve conditions such as abnormal lipid metabolism. Among them, treatments such as liposuction achieve therapeutic effects by filtering excess fat from the blood. In this process, the blood needs to be purified through an external circuit before being returned to the body. Maintaining a stable temperature during blood return is a key step in ensuring treatment comfort and safety.
[0003] The normal human body temperature is maintained at around 37Β°C. When blood leaves the circulatory system and enters the extracorporeal circuit, it is easily subject to heat loss due to the influence of ambient temperature, causing the blood temperature to drop. If this cooled blood is directly reinfused into the body, the patient will experience significant cold discomfort, and it may even trigger adverse reactions such as vasoconstriction and chills, affecting the treatment experience and progress. To solve this problem, the industry currently widely uses a heating plate to regulate the temperature of the blood in the extracorporeal circuit. By guiding the blood through the tubing in contact with the heating plate, the blood temperature is maintained at around 37Β°C, close to the human body temperature, thus reducing discomfort during reinfusion.
[0004] However, the tubing used in blood purification circuits needs to be designed with a specific coiled shape according to the layout of the treatment equipment and ergonomic requirements. Especially when used with a heating plate, the tubing needs to fit tightly against the heating surface to ensure heat exchange efficiency, while maintaining a stable coiled structure to avoid abnormal flow caused by tubing bending or displacement. Existing tubing coiling and shaping techniques have several problems: First, the tubing is very prone to loosening after normal coiling but before being fixed. To prevent loosening, manual glue application is required while coiling, making the process cumbersome. Second, the coil shape is inconsistent. Due to manual operation, the size of the coil varies greatly depending on the technique and tightness, making it difficult to ensure precise contact between the tubing and the heating plate, thus affecting temperature control. Third, manual operation results in extremely low output and efficiency, and the process is difficult, failing to meet the needs of large-scale production.
[0005] Therefore, the technical problem to be solved in this application is to develop a positioning fixture that can accurately control the curling shape of the pipeline, ensure the stability of the shaping, and be compatible with various pipeline specifications. Utility Model Content

[0007] The technical solution adopted by this utility model to solve its technical problem is: a positioning fixture for coiling and shaping pipelines, including a base plate and a limiting frame; the base plate has a placement station for placing pipelines, and the base plate is provided with detachable limiting blocks on the four sides corresponding to the placement station. The limiting blocks have an arc-shaped groove for cooperating with the pipeline on the side facing the placement station; the limiting frame is disposed on the upper side of the placement station and is detachably connected to the base plate, and the limiting frame is provided with a pressure strip corresponding to each limiting block. The pressure strip extends to the upper side of the limiting block and is used to press against the pipeline placed at the placement station.
[0008] The placement station is equipped with a spiral groove structure, which is used to clamp the disc-shaped structure formed after the pipe is wound. The groove width of the spiral groove structure is adapted to the outer diameter of the pipe.
[0009] The limiting block is slidably mounted on the base plate.
[0010] The limiting frame is a metal frame.
[0011] The beneficial effects of this utility model are as follows:
[0012] 1. The placement station on the base plate provides a clear placement reference for the pipeline. Combined with the four removable limiting blocks, the arc-shaped grooves on the side of the limiting blocks facing the placement station can fit against the outer wall of the pipeline, reliably limiting the pipeline from the side and preventing lateral displacement during the shaping process. This, along with the pressure strips on the limiting frame, forms a double limiting effect, ensuring that the pipeline can be rolled and shaped strictly according to the preset form.
[0013] 2. Because the limiting block adopts a detachable design and its position on the base plate can be adjusted according to actual needs, the fixture can be adapted to pipes with different diameters and different coiling parameters. Attached Figure Description

[0016] Example 1: As Figure 1 As shown, a positioning fixture for coiling and shaping pipelines includes a base plate 1 and a limiting frame 2.
[0017] The base plate 1 has a placement station 3 for placing pipes. The size and shape of the placement station 3 are designed according to the actual pipe dimensions and winding requirements. In this embodiment, the placement station 3 is provided with a spiral groove structure 4, which is used to hold the disc-shaped structure formed after the pipe is wound. The groove width of the spiral groove structure 4 is adapted to the outer diameter of the pipe, so that when the pipe is wound into a disc shape, it can be precisely held in the spiral groove structure 4, effectively preventing the pipe from shifting during the shaping process and ensuring the shaping effect.
[0018] On the base plate 1, detachable limiting blocks 5 are respectively provided on the four sides corresponding to the placement station 3. The limiting blocks 5 are made of engineering plastic, which is lightweight and has a certain degree of wear resistance. The side of the limiting block 5 facing the placement station 3 has an arc-shaped groove 6 for matching with the pipeline. The curvature of the arc-shaped groove 6 is adapted to the outer circumference curvature of the pipeline, so that the limiting block 5 can better fit with the pipeline and play a limiting role for the pipeline.
[0019] The limiting block 5 is slidably mounted on the base plate 1. Specifically, the base plate 1 has a corresponding groove for the limiting block 5, and the bottom end of the limiting block 5 slides into the groove, thus forming a sliding fit with the base plate 1. This sliding fit between the limiting block 5 and the base plate 1 allows the position of the limiting block 5 on the base plate 1 to be adjusted according to the actual size and curling position of the pipeline, improving the versatility of the fixture. Simultaneously, the limiting block 5 and the base plate 1 are detachably connected by bolts 8. After the limiting block 5 is adjusted to the appropriate position, it is fixed to the base plate 1 by bolts 8, ensuring that the limiting block 5 will not move during the pipeline shaping process.
[0020] The limiting frame 2 is located on the upper side of the placement station 3 and is detachably connected to the base plate 1. In this embodiment, the limiting frame 2 is a metal frame, and the limiting frame 2 and the base plate 1 are detachably connected by bolts.
[0021] Each limiting bracket 2 has a pressure strip 9 corresponding to each limiting block 5. The pressure strip 9 is made of elastic metal material and has a certain elastic deformation capability. The pressure strip 9 extends to the upper side of the limiting block 5 and is used to press against the pipeline installed at the placement station 3. An elastic buffer layer 11 is provided on the side of the pressure strip 9 facing the pipeline. The elastic buffer layer 11 is made of silicone material and can play a buffering role when the pressure strip 9 presses against the pipeline, so as to avoid damage to the pipeline by the pressure strip 9.
[0022] Example 2: A permanent magnet is embedded inside the limiting block 5, which is used to magnetically attract and cooperate with the limiting frame 2.
[0023] Example 3: An electromagnet is embedded inside the limiting block 5, which is used to engage with the limiting frame 2 through magnetic attraction.
[0024] In use, the positioning fixture for pipe coiling and shaping according to the present invention first adjusts the position of the limiting block 5 on the base plate 1 according to the pipe size and coiling requirements, and fixes it with bolts 8. Then, the pipe is wound into a disc shape and inserted into the spiral groove structure 4 of the placement station 3. Next, the limiting frame 2 is installed on the base plate 1 with bolts, so that the pressure strip 9 extends to the upper side of the limiting block 5 and presses against the pipe. Finally, the exposed part of the pipe is glued and shaped.
